Phone line for Businesses or Individuals. Ring4 provides companies with a cloud solution to manage phone lines as simply as they manage emails. The Ring4 work on any iOS or Android device and can be managed via the Admin Console. Ring4 phone numbers are mobile and support unlimited texting, unlimited calling, voicemail and call recording. Ring4 starts at $9.99/month/line.

textPlus features and specs

  • Cost-effective Communication
    textPlus offers free texting and inexpensive calling options, making it a budget-friendly choice for users looking to save on communication expenses.
  • Wi-Fi Connectivity
    Allows users to send and receive texts and calls over Wi-Fi, which is convenient for users who have limited cellular service or are traveling internationally.
  • Multiple Platform Availability
    Available on both iOS and Android platforms, ensuring a wide user base and flexibility for users to switch between devices.
  • No Need for a SIM Card
    Users can communicate without needing a physical SIM card, which is beneficial for users who are using devices like tablets which don't have a traditional phone function.

Possible disadvantages of textPlus

  • Inconsistent Message Delivery
    Users may experience occasional issues with message delays or failures, which can affect the reliability of the service.
  • Ad-Supported Free Version
    The free version of the app contains advertisements, which some users may find intrusive or annoying.
  • Limited International Calling
    While domestic calls in certain regions are low-cost, international calling rates can vary and might not be as competitive as other services.
  • Privacy Concerns
    As with any communication app, users should be aware of the privacy policies and potential data collection practices associated with the service.

Ring4 features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Ring4 offers an intuitive interface that makes it simple for users to sign up, manage multiple numbers, and access voicemail. This user-friendly design is ideal for people who are not tech-savvy.
  • Affordability
    The service is cost-effective compared to traditional phone plans, providing a low-cost option for businesses and individuals who need additional phone lines without the overhead of another physical device.
  • Flexibility
    Ring4 allows users to create and manage multiple phone numbers on a single device. This feature is particularly beneficial for small businesses and freelancers needing separate lines for different purposes or clients.
  • Privacy
    Users can separate their personal and professional calls by using different phone numbers on the same device, thereby protecting their privacy and keeping their personal number confidential.
  • Cloud-Based Service
    Because it is a cloud-based service, calling, texting, and other functionalities can be accessed from multiple devices, enabling better work-from-anywhere flexibility.

Possible disadvantages of Ring4

  • Call Quality
    As Ring4 relies on internet connectivity for calls, the quality can be inconsistent, especially in areas with poor network coverage or fluctuating internet speeds.
  • Limited International Coverage
    While it provides excellent service within the U.S., international coverage may be limited or incur additional costs compared to other VoIP providers.
  • Feature Limitations
    Ring4 may lack some advanced features offered by traditional business phone systems, such as advanced call routing, CRM integrations, or extensive analytics.
  • Dependence on Smartphones
    Ring4 primarily works on smartphones, which might be limiting for users who prefer desktop solutions or need a more traditional desk phone setup.
  • Subscription Model
    The service requires ongoing subscriptions, and while generally affordable, some users may find the monthly fees burdensome over time compared to one-time costs associated with traditional phone services.
